It has been noted that the Montreal Canadiens won Game 7 of their series with the Tampa Bay Lightning on Sunday night with a Stanley Cup Playoff record-low nine shots on goal. This is clearly not true. It was eight. It can only be nine if we are defining "on" as "behind," and "goal" as "the goalie's behind."
This matters because the Canadiens won the game, 2-1, and so stole the series despite being dominated by the Lightning in all the ways that the visible eye could discern, provided you're no
